Crisis Response Training

Professionals and volunteers who work in public service are invited to attend a training on the City of Holland’s Crisis Response Plan on either Thursday, February 29 from 3-5 pm or Thursday, March 14 from 3-5 pm. Both trainings will be held at City Hall. Registration is at Eventbrite.

The City’s Crisis Response Plan (CRP) is a community strategy to prepare for, respond to, mitigate, and restore community balance should the community be faced with a hate crime, racial or bias incident, or perception of racial or bias incident.

The training will also focus on immigration law and understanding victim trauma.

Presenters include representatives from the Ottawa County Prosecutor’s Office, Lighthouse Immigrant Advocates, the Flourishing Collective, and City of Holland Public Safety.

This free training is offered to make sure everyone involved in public service is up to speed on Holland’s Crisis Response Plan.
